Verify on Other Blockchains (Same Etherscan API Key)

Etherscan API V2 uses one API key for all supported chains. This repo uses ETHERSCAN_API_KEY in .env for every chain.

V2 endpoint

All verification uses: https://api.etherscan.io/v2/api?chainid=<chainId>&apikey=...
The plugin sends the correct chainId from the Hardhat network.

Networks and verify command

Network Chain ID Verify --network Explorer
Mainnet 1 mainnet etherscan.io
Sepolia 11155111 sepolia sepolia.etherscan.io
BSC 56 bsc bscscan.com
Polygon 137 polygon polygonscan.com
Gnosis 100 gnosis gnosisscan.io
Optimism 10 optimism optimistic.etherscan.io
Base 8453 base basescan.org
Arbitrum 42161 arbitrum arbiscan.io
Avalanche 43114 avalanche snowtrace.io

Cronos (25) is not in Etherscan V2 supported chains; use Cronoscan if needed.

Verify CCIPLogger on other chains

Option A script (recommended)
From repo root (smom-dbis-138):

./scripts/deployment/verify-ccip-logger-other-chains.sh

The script reads CCIP_LOGGER_* and CCIP_*_ROUTER from .env and runs Hardhat verify for each chain that has both set. Requires ETHERSCAN_API_KEY and PRIVATE_KEY in .env.

Option B manual (per chain)
Constructor args: (address router, address authorizedSigner, uint64 expectedSourceChainSelector) with authorizedSigner = 0x0000...0000 and source chain selector 138.

# Example: BSC (replace with your deployed address and router from .env)
npx hardhat verify --network bsc <CCIP_LOGGER_BSC> "<CCIP_BSC_ROUTER>" "0x0000000000000000000000000000000000000000" 138

Same pattern for polygon, gnosis, optimism, base, arbitrum, avalanche. Ref: deploy-ccip-logger-multichain.js, docs.etherscan.io/v2-migration.
